The post involves undertaking two key roles Specialist Assistant Psychologist (approx. 0.6 FTE) Key duties may include Undertaking 1:1 CBT work under regular supervision with a Clinical Psychologist Observing and contributing to psychological assessment Undertaking group work, including co-facilitating the CBT informed waiting list group and the service user co-production group Managing and conducting data collection and analysis, and producing reports for the senior clinical management team Supporting the development of service user participation in outcome monitoring and service development Contributing to training in new systems and protocols for clinical outcome monitoring and evaluation Working with data staff to upload parent service data into Open Door's central system, enabling clinical outcomes to become more accessible Developing data management systems and strategies for uploads to NHS England Undertaking other research and evaluation activities in order to support service development Training therapists on outcome measure collection / data capturing systems Clinical Administrator (approx. 0.4 FTE) This post will provide administrative support for all clinical services within Open Door. This may include delivering the following functions a) Referrals, appointments and clinical administration Take and process referrals Correspondence and communication with patients, professionals and other contacts by letter, telephone, e-mail, etc. Set up appointments in the patient management database and ensure patient records are up to date at all times Provide administrative support to Open Door's clinical team Ensure that patients attending appointments are appropriately greeted Liaison and co-operation with other administrative staff, volunteers, and the clinical team Organisation of waiting room, resources and notice boards Organisation of room bookings for Open Door and private therapists Booking and maintaining records for interpretation services Support the Intake Team to ensure that the waiting list is properly managed and updated Communicating with and having knowledge of other local services as required Open Door uses a patient management database called Clinic Office, together with Microsoft Office 365, to aid the administration of these functions. The post holder is expected to be proficient in the use of these software packages, although training will be provided for Clinic Office. We are currently in the middle of a data transformation project which will include new systems for collecting and analysing outcome measures. The post holder will receive training and be expected to support the clinical team in implementation. b) Information systems Administration of outcome measures completed by patients at key stages in their treatment Helping to prepare information for the management of Open Door's work or for external funders c) Other Support Responsibility for opening and closing the office Ensuring the facilities are neat, tidy and welcoming at all times Ability to take on smaller one-off tasks / projects aimed at improving administrative processes Offer administrative support to additional projects where required, such as the production and distribution of Open Door's annual report, organising public events or contributing to the process of funding applications GENERAL a) This is not an exhaustive list of duties and responsibilities, and the post holder may be required to undertake other duties which fall within the grade of the job, in discussion with the Senior Clinical Administrator, Psychology Lead or CEO. b) This job description may be reviewed in the light of changing service requirements; any such changes will be discussed with the post holder.
